摘要
地铁与综合管廊作为城市中网络化建设的重大市政工程,所处地下空间具有高度的相似性和重合性,因此,统筹规划设计有利于地下空间的利用和工程投资的节约。然而,早期的地铁工程没有为综合管廊预留建设条件,造成交叉段管廊功能削弱等一系列问题。基于目前南京市轨道交通线网和地下综合管廊规划,全面梳理了两者的建设时序和空间关系,研究了各种情况下地铁与综合管廊协调建设的关键技术对策,供类似工程参考。
Subway and utility tunnel are the major municipal engineering projects in the urban network construction.The underground space occupied is highly similar and coincident.A coordination planning and design can effectively utilize underground space and save engineering investment.The early subway project did not reserve conditions for the construction of utility tunnel,resulting in a series of problems such as weakening the function of utility tunnel.Based on present Nanjing rail transit network and Nanjing underground utility tunnel planning,comprehensively sorts out the construction temporal and spatial relation between the two,studies the key technical solutions for the coordinated construction,provides a reference to related projects.
